The main purpose of this paper is to analyze the classes of disjoint hypercyclic and disjoint topologically mixing abstract degenerate (multi-term) fractional differential equations in Banach and Fréchet function spaces. We focus special attention on the analysis of abstract degenerate differential equations of first and second order, when we also consider disjoint chaos as a linear topological dynamical property. We provide several illustrative examples and applications of our abstract results. | URI: | https://open.uns.ac.rs/handle/123456789/1496 | ISSN: | 1066369X | DOI: | 10.3103/S1066369X18070034 |
